NEWPORT NEWS, Va. - Christopher Newport's women's athletic teams won more than any other in the commonwealth during the 2019-2020 season. The news was announced Friday by the Virginia Sports Information Directors (VaSID) as the organization released its annual statewide survey of Division III programs.
The Captains won 74.4 percent of their women's contests during the season, posting a 99-33-3 record. Women's Soccer (16-3-3), Volleyball (27-9), Field Hockey (14-5), Women's Basketball (25-4), and Softball (12-1) led the way as Christopher Newport edged out Washington & Lee for the top spot.
On the men's side, Christopher Newport teams finished third in the state after recording a record of 56-26-5 for a 67.2 percent winning clip. Men's Soccer (14-2-5), Men's Basketball (23-6), Baseball (10-4), and Men's Lacrosse (5-1) enjoyed the most success.
Overall, Christopher Newport squads registered a record of 155-59-8 for a 71.6 winning percentage, finishing third in the state behind Washington & Lee and Randolph-Macon.
VaSID names 44 all-state teams in 23 sports each year, as well as an Academic All-State squad and an all-sports champion in both the University and College Divisions. Membership in VaSID is open to all media relations professionals working at a university or conference in the state of Virginia.
